Why does the electric field inside a charged conducting shell remain zero even when an external field is applied?

Explanation

Charges on the conductor’s surface redistribute to cancel any external field inside, creating an electrostatic shield. This shielding effect ensures the internal field is zero, as charges adjust to maintain equilibrium within the conductor.
